4-1-2 Recording Time Code and User Bit Values

There are the following four ways of recording time code:
• Internal Preset mode, which records the output of the
internal time code generator, set beforehand to an initial
value. The following run modes can be selected.
- Free Run: Time code advances continually.
- Rec Run: Time code advances only during recording.
• Internal Regen mode, which records the output of the
internal time code generator, initialized to time code
following continuously upon the time code of the last
frame of the last clip on the disc.
• External Regen mode, which records the output of the
internal time code generator, synchronized to an external
time code generator. As the external input, the time code
input to any of the following connectors can be selected.

To record time code after setting an initial
value
Set the following extended menu items to the specified
values.
• Item 626 "TC MODE": "int preset"
• Item 627 "RUN MODE": "free run" or "rec run"
• Item 628 "DF MODE": "on (df)" or "off (ndf)"
See 8-3-2 "Extended Menu Operations" (page 120) for
more information about how to make extended menu
settings.
Then set an initial value as described below, and carry out
recording (see page 54).

• External Preset mode, which directly records the input of
an external time code generator. As the external input,
the time code input to any of the following connectors
can be selected.
- TIME CODE IN connector: TC
-
S400 (i.LINK) connector: TC
